Emergence of Hybrid Cloud Solutions
The emergence of hybrid cloud solutions is reshaping the landscape of the autonomous data-platform market. Canadian organizations are increasingly adopting hybrid models that combine on-premises infrastructure with cloud capabilities. This approach allows businesses to leverage the scalability and flexibility of cloud services while maintaining control over sensitive data. The hybrid cloud market is projected to grow significantly, with estimates suggesting a CAGR of around 30% in the coming years. This shift not only enhances operational efficiency but also drives the demand for autonomous data platforms that can seamlessly integrate with both cloud and on-premises environments, thereby expanding their applicability across various sectors.
Rising Demand for Real-Time Analytics
The autonomous data-platform market experiences a notable surge in demand for real-time analytics solutions. Organizations in Canada increasingly seek to harness data insights instantaneously to enhance decision-making processes. This trend is driven by the need for agility in operations, particularly in sectors such as finance and retail, where timely data can lead to competitive advantages. According to recent estimates, the market for real-time analytics is projected to grow at a CAGR of approximately 25% over the next five years. This growth indicates a robust appetite for platforms that can process and analyze data streams in real-time, thereby propelling the autonomous data-platform market forward.

Integration of Advanced Machine Learning Algorithms
The integration of advanced machine learning algorithms into data platforms is transforming the autonomous data-platform market. Canadian enterprises are increasingly adopting these technologies to automate data processing and enhance predictive analytics capabilities. By leveraging machine learning, organizations can uncover hidden patterns and trends within their data, leading to more informed strategic decisions. The market for machine learning in data analytics is expected to reach $2 billion by 2026 in Canada, reflecting a growing recognition of the value that these technologies bring to the autonomous data-platform market. This integration not only improves efficiency but also fosters innovation across various industries.
